Aldi To Eliminate 44 Ingredients From Private Label Products By 2027

Aldi is expanding its standards by removing an additional 44 ingredients from private label food, vitamin and supplement products, including select artificial preservatives, colors, flavors and sweeteners. Handwritten Recipe Of Schnucks Founder Resurfaces After Decades

Schnucks has brought back its founder’s long-lost recipe for potato salad that recently was rediscovered by her granddaughter. Anna Schnuck’s Original Potato Salad, made using that 1939 recipe, is now available in the deli/prepared foods department at all Schnucks locations. Metcalfe’s Market Celebrates Earth Day With Student-Designed Bags

For the 12th consecutive year, Wisconsin-based Metcalfe’s Market will celebrate Earth Day on April 22 with its community tradition of distributing 3,000 reusable shopping bags featuring original artwork from students at 10 local elementary schools. ARS Launches Pathmark Daily Small Format Grocery Store

Allegiance Retail Services (ARS) will open a new small format grocery banner, Pathmark Daily, on May 1 at 625 Merrick Ave. in East Meadow, New York. Pathmark Daily aims to deliver convenience, quality and value to shoppers through an assortment of fresh foods and grocery essentials – including produce, meats, seafood and everyday staples. Natural Grocers Celebrates Arbor Day In Nebraska With Gifts, Savings

Natural Grocers will host its annual Arbor Day event April 24-26 at its three stores in Nebraska, the state where the holiday originated. Natural Grocers is headquartered in Lakewood, Colorado, but the company entered neighboring Nebraska in 2012 with the opening of its first store in Lincoln. Sendik’s Receives WI Governor’s Proclamation For 100th Anniversary

Wisconsin Gov. Tony Evers has issued a certificate of commendation to the Balistreri family, which owns and operates Sendik’s Food Market, recognizing the grocer’s 100-year anniversary. Mike Semmann, president and CEO of the Wisconsin Grocers Association, presented the certificate to co-owner Ted Balistreri on April 22 at the Sendik’s in Mequon, Wisconsin. Piggly Wiggly Completes Major Store Remodel In Racine, WI

Piggly Wiggly has completed a major refresh of its store at 4011 Durand Ave., one of three locations in Racine, Wisconsin, bringing expanded fresh offerings and refreshed departments. The remodel, the store’s most significant update in 15 years, focused on areas identified through customer and employee feedback during the upgrade. Stop & Shop Supports Cancer Patients Through Gift Card Donation

The Joe Andruzzi Foundation, Stop & Shop and Poland Spring gathered at the Sturdy Health Cancer and Specialty Care Building for a Food Security Program event focused on assisting cancer patients and families with practical support during treatment.
